When monitoring a patient under anesthesia, how long after administration should the heart rate and respiratory rate be documented?

Explanation:
Monitoring a patient under anesthesia is a critical aspect of veterinary care, as it ensures the safety and well-being of the animal throughout the procedure. Documenting the heart rate and respiratory rate immediately after administration provides a baseline of the patient's vital signs during anesthesia, which is essential for assessing how the animal is responding to the anesthetic agents. Recording this data right away allows the veterinary team to detect any immediate adverse reactions or complications that may arise soon after the induction of anesthesia. Early documentation reflects an accurate picture of the patient's condition and facilitates timely interventions if necessary. Monitoring vital signs regularly during the anesthesia process is commonplace, but noting them immediately is crucial for establishing those baseline parameters that can be referenced throughout the entirety of the anesthesia event. This ensures that any changes can be recognized and addressed promptly, underscoring the importance of initial monitoring right after the administration of anesthetic agents.
